Ezra Robinson's Skip-Ace Gives Disc Golf Some Helpful Attention


ree

This week, Ezra Robinson aced the par-three 436-foot first hole during match play at the Krokhol Open in Norway.


Robinson's blast of a backhand drive landed 10 feet in front of the basket, then skipped in.


The throw was so impressive that it made the #1 spot in SportsCenter's Top Ten Highlights for July 11, 2025.


A great throw for Ezra. And it also brings some helpful attention to disc golf.
